1.2. Streaming Services for NBA Games

If you've cut the cord or prefer streaming, several services offer NBA games. Keep in mind that subscription fees and blackout restrictions may apply. Bengals Game Tonight: Your Ultimate Watch Guide

  • NBA League Pass: The NBA's official streaming service provides access to live and on-demand games. Depending on your subscription tier, you can watch every game or just specific teams. Blackout restrictions are in place for games broadcast in your local market.
  • Streaming Services with Live TV: Services such as YouTube TV, Sling TV, Hulu + Live TV, and fuboTV often include the channels that broadcast NBA games (ESPN, TNT, ABC, etc.). These are excellent options if you want a complete TV package with sports.

4. Understanding Blackout Restrictions

Blackout restrictions can be frustrating, but they are common in sports broadcasting. They prevent local viewers from watching games that are being broadcast on a regional or national network through a streaming service.

4.1. Local Market Blackouts

If a game is being shown on your local RSN, NBA League Pass will likely have a blackout for that game. This is because the local network has exclusive broadcasting rights within the region.

4.2. National TV Blackouts

Games broadcast on national networks such as ESPN or TNT may also be blacked out on some streaming services in your local market.
